What is the difference between rejuran polynucleotide injections and other skin boosters?

Understanding the Core Difference: Mechanism of Action

At its heart, the fundamental difference between rejuran polynucleotide injections and most other skin boosters boils down to their primary mechanism of action within the skin. While many skin boosters are primarily hydrators designed to plump the skin by binding water, rejuran injections function as bio-regenerative stimulators. They don’t just add temporary volume; they communicate with your skin cells to kickstart your body’s own natural healing and repair processes, leading to more structural and long-lasting improvements.

Most conventional skin boosters, like those based on non-cross-linked hyaluronic acid (HA), work like a super-charged sponge. The HA molecules draw and hold vast amounts of water into the dermis, the skin’s middle layer. This immediately improves hydration, reduces the appearance of fine lines, and gives a dewy glow. However, since the HA is eventually broken down by the body, these effects are temporary, typically lasting a few months. Rejuran, on the other hand, is derived from purified Polynucleotide (PN) chains sourced from salmon DNA. These PNs are biologically compatible and act as signaling molecules. When injected, they are recognized by fibroblasts—the skin’s collagen-producing factories—promoting cell proliferation, reducing inflammation, and significantly boosting the production of new, high-quality collagen and elastin. Think of it as giving your skin’s repair crew a detailed blueprint and the resources to rebuild the foundation, rather than just painting over the cracks.

The Ingredient Breakdown: Polynucleotides vs. Hyaluronic Acid

This core difference in mechanism stems from the active ingredients themselves. Let’s break down the key players.

Rejuran’s Active Ingredient: Polynucleotides (PNs)

  • Source: Highly purified and fragmented DNA molecules, typically from salmon. The source is chosen for its biocompatibility and similarity to human DNA.
  • Primary Function: Bio-stimulation. PNs promote tissue repair, enhance cellular energy metabolism (via ATP production), and have anti-inflammatory properties.
  • Effect on Skin: Improves skin elasticity, firmness, and texture from within by increasing collagen density. It’s particularly noted for its ability to improve skin quality in delicate areas like the under-eyes and neck.

Standard Skin Boosters’ Active Ingredient: Hyaluronic Acid (HA)

  • Source: Can be bio-fermented or derived from animal sources. It’s a glycosaminoglycan, a sugar molecule naturally found in our skin.
  • Primary Function: Hydration. A single HA molecule can hold up to 1000 times its weight in water.
  • Effect on Skin: Provides immediate hydration, plumping, and a radiant glow by increasing the water content in the dermis.

Treatment Experience and Protocol: A Different Journey

Because their goals are different, the treatment protocols for Rejuran versus standard skin boosters can vary significantly. This is a crucial practical difference for anyone considering these treatments.

A typical regimen for a standard HA skin booster, like Profhilo or Teosyal Redensity, often involves two initial sessions, spaced about a month apart. The results are relatively quick to appear, with optimal hydration and glow achieved a few weeks after the second session. Maintenance treatments are then usually recommended every 6-9 months.

Rejuran treatment, however, is often approached as a more intensive regenerative course. A common protocol might involve 3 initial sessions, each spaced 3-4 weeks apart. This staggered approach allows for a cumulative effect, giving the skin ample time to respond to the bio-stimulatory signals and begin the slow process of neocollagenesis (new collagen formation). You won’t see a dramatic change after the first session; the results build gradually over 2 to 3 months as your skin remodels itself. Many practitioners and clinics, such as rejuran specialists, emphasize this need for patience, as the payoff is a more fundamental improvement in skin health that can last longer—often up to 12 months or more after completing the initial course. Maintenance might then be a single session per year.

Targeted Concerns: Which One Addresses What?

Your specific skin concerns will largely determine which treatment is more suitable. They are not necessarily interchangeable but can sometimes be complementary.

Choose Rejuran if your primary concerns are:

  • Loss of Elasticity and Firmness: If your skin feels lax, especially on the neck or jawline, Rejuran’s collagen-boosting action is targeted here.
  • Fine, Crepey Skin Texture: It excels at improving the quality of thin, fragile skin, like under the eyes or on the décolletage.
  • Acne Scarring or Traumatic Scars: The regenerative and anti-inflammatory properties of PNs can help remodel scar tissue, softening the appearance of pitted or uneven scars.
  • Overall Skin “Quality”: It’s less about a temporary glow and more about creating stronger, more resilient skin architecture.

Choose a Standard HA Skin Booster if your primary concerns are:

  • Intense Dehydration: If your skin feels tight, flaky, and lacks moisture, the direct hydrating effect of HA is unparalleled.
  • Dull, Tired-Looking Skin: The immediate plumping effect gives a refreshed, radiant appearance.
  • Early, Fine Lines: Lines caused primarily by dryness will be visibly reduced as the skin is hydrated.
  • Preparing the Skin: HA boosters are fantastic as a primer before major events or as a foundational treatment to hydrate the skin before more regenerative treatments like Rejuran.

Longevity and Results: Temporary Hydration vs. Lasting Change

This is where the “investment versus expense” analogy often comes into play. The longevity of results is directly tied to the mechanism of action.

Standard HA Skin Boosters provide results that are impressive but finite. The body steadily metabolizes the injected hyaluronic acid. As the water-binding capacity diminishes, the skin gradually returns to its pre-treatment level of hydration. This is why maintenance sessions are essential, typically every 6 to 9 months, to sustain the effect. It’s a cyclical process of replenishment.

Rejuran aims for a more permanent shift in skin quality—within the natural limits of aging, of course. By stimulating your body to produce its own new collagen and elastin, you are effectively adding to the structural scaffolding of your skin. This new tissue has a natural lifespan. While the stimulation effect of the injected PNs wears off after several months, the collagen that was created during that period remains for much longer. This is why the results appear gradually and why a single initial course of treatments can provide benefits that persist for 12 months or more. You are not just refilling a tank; you are upgrading the engine.

Combination Approaches: The Synergistic Effect

It’s important to note that these treatments are not always an “either/or” proposition. In fact, many advanced aesthetic practices use them together synergistically. A popular approach is to first prepare the skin with a course of HA-based boosters to achieve optimal hydration. A well-hydrated dermis is a healthier environment for cellular processes. Following this, a course of Rejuran can be administered to build upon that hydrated base by stimulating new collagen, leading to skin that is not only plump and glowing but also fundamentally firmer and more elastic. This combination addresses both the symptom (dehydration) and the cause (loss of structural support) of skin aging.
